Short version: A main topic area that a brand returns to consistently in its content.
In social content work, content pillar helps shape how a brand earns attention and keeps it useful. It can affect the topic, format, timing, creator brief, profile experience, or the way performance is read after publishing. A good social decision connects the content idea with the audience’s context, not only with what the brand wants to say.
It matters because social media should not only fill a calendar. Each post or profile element should have a role: attract the right people, explain value, create trust, or move someone toward a next step. If the role is unclear, the content may look busy while doing very little for the business.
